"""
aws_advanced_python_wrapper -- PEP249 base classes

    Exceptions
    |__Warning
    |__Error
       |__InterfaceError
       |__DatabaseError
          |__DataError
          |__OperationalError
          |__IntegrityError
          |__InternalError
          |__ProgrammingError
          |__NotSupportedError

"""

from __future__ import annotations

from typing import TYPE_CHECKING

if TYPE_CHECKING:
    from types import TracebackType

from typing import Any, Iterator, List, Optional, Type, TypeVar


class Warning(Exception):
    __module__ = "aws_advanced_python_wrapper"


class Error(Exception):
    __module__ = "aws_advanced_python_wrapper"


class InterfaceError(Error):
    __module__ = "aws_advanced_python_wrapper"


class DatabaseError(Error):
    __module__ = "aws_advanced_python_wrapper"


class DataError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class OperationalError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class IntegrityError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class InternalError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class ProgrammingError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class NotSupportedError(DatabaseError):
    __module__ = "aws_advanced_python_wrapper"


class ConnectionTimeout(OperationalError):
    ...


class PipelineAborted(OperationalError):
    ...
